Job Description
The Fiscal Assistant provides important assistance to the Fiscal Supervisor in various areas of accounting, such as, filing, shredding, logging and printing. The Fiscal Assistant will also help with the preparation of Agency Risk Management and Internal Control Standards and Inventory. Additional responsibilities also include, but are not limited to:
- Keeping mailroom organized and maintain all mailing supplies
- Preparing invoices for book sales
- Assist with daily deposits, printing labels and reviewing batches for accuracy
- Providing agency support by assisting accounts payable, accounts receivable, and other support services
- Processing for museum memberships and donations
- Running reports, letters, and printing cards through our donor database
As part of a collaborative and dynamic team, the Fiscal Assistant may support a variety of museum-wide initiatives, including participation in science-based public festivals and special events. All team members contribute to the planning and execution of these community-focused programs, which are core to the museum’s outreach and educational mission.
Qualifications
For this position, the museum is seeking candidates who have an understanding of state accounting principles, office equipment skills, word processing, spreadsheet and database software. (e.g. Word, Excel, PowerPoint). Preference is for candidates who have an AAS in Accounting.
